Cyrillic Small Letter Pe Letter Meaning

п is the Cyrillic small letter “pe” (Unicode U+043F). In Cyrillic alphabets, it represents the sound typically associated with the Latin “p” in many languages (the exact phonetic value can vary slightly by language and position). It is a letter used to form common words, names, and abbreviations. If you’re working with Russian or other Cyrillic-based texts, you’ll encounter п frequently in normal writing. What Unicode character is “п”?

“п” is Cyrillic small letter Pe with Unicode code point U+043F.

Does “п” mean the same as the Latin letter “p”?

They look similar in some fonts, but they are different characters. “п” is Cyrillic small letter Pe; it’s used in Cyrillic alphabets and represents a related sound depending on the language.
